Philippe Battikha

Montreal based artist, musician, composer, and community organizer.

At the heart of my practice lies an obsession with sound. Following in a tradition of sound-artists and composers such as Max Neuhaus and R. Murray Schafer, my work focuses on the belief that in today’s visually driven society we must pay closer attention to the impact and importance aural environments play in our lives.

By recontextualizing habitual sounds and exposing specific aural properties in sound installations, sculptures, and controlled sound environments, I explore the relationships we have to the sounds that surround us, and their affect on our experiences.

Using sound as a medium is also a way of raising the alarm on a growing cultural disregard for material waste inherent in consumer capitalism.
